Written question asked by Keith Simpson (Conservative) on Wednesday, 17 December 2008,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Monday, 12 January 2009. It was answered by Baroness Merron (Labour) on Wednesday, 21 January 2009 on behalf of the Foreign and Commonwealth Office.


Democratic Republic of Congo: Mining

Question
To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s which UK-based companies have been involved in the exportation of (a) cassiterite, (b) coltan and (c) wolframite from the Democratic Republic of Congo, as referred to in the report of 12 December 2008 by the UN panel of experts (S/2008/773).
Answer

We are aware of a number of UK-based companies involved in mining in the Democratic Republic of Congo, although precise details of their activities are not held. Only one—Afrimex, which is involved in the exportation of cassiterite—is referred to by name in the UN panel of experts report.
